Understanding the Mechanics of Escalating Flights

The fundamental principle behind the escalating flights in this game revolves around a Random Number Generator (RNG). This sophisticated algorithm dictates the point at which the airplane malfunctions and ‘crashes’. The RNG ensures that each round is independent and unpredictable, meaning past results have no bearing on future outcomes. This randomness is critical for maintaining fairness and integrity within the game. Players can’t predict the exact moment of the crash; they can only rely on probability and their own intuition. Different game providers employ slightly different RNG implementations, but the core concept remains consistent: unbiased, unpredictable outcomes. Understanding this is paramount to managing expectations and adopting a responsible approach to gameplay. It's crucial to remember that it is a game of chance and not a skill-based game.

The Psychology of Risk and Reward in Escalating Games

The inherent appeal of the aviator game lies in its exploitation of fundamental psychological principles related to risk and reward. The increasing multiplier creates a sense of anticipation and excitement, triggering the release of dopamine in the brain. This neurochemical reinforces the desire to continue playing, hoping for a larger payout. The near-miss effect – where the plane crashes just after you cash out – can be particularly frustrating, but it also serves to heighten the emotional investment in the game. The illusion of control can also play a role, as players may believe they can somehow influence the outcome by timing their cashout perfectly, even though the game is entirely based on chance. Understanding these psychological biases can help players make more rational decisions and avoid falling victim to impulsive behavior.

The Gambler's Fallacy and Cognitive Distortions

The gambler’s fallacy, the belief that past events influence future outcomes in a random sequence, is a common cognitive distortion that can affect players’ judgment. For example, a player who has experienced a series of losses may believe that a win is ‘due,’ leading them to increase their bet size. This is a flawed line of reasoning, as each round of the aviator game is independent of the previous ones. Other cognitive distortions, such as confirmation bias (focusing on information that confirms existing beliefs) and overconfidence bias (overestimating one's abilities), can also contribute to poor decision-making. Being aware of these biases is the first step towards mitigating their impact and playing more strategically. Regular self-assessment and objective analysis of your game performance are crucial for identifying and correcting these cognitive distortions.
